-Management is hyper-focused on staffing efficiency. This often results in consultants being staffed/extended on projects that do not fully utilize their skill sets, much less challenge them.
-Many consultants remain at the same clients for extended periods of time.
-Main paths to career advancement are through taking on management responsibilities as opposed to increased technical proficiency.
-Employee development is treaded as something to be handled in addition to 40+ billable hours each week. Offering internal projects, training, tech challenges and other extracurricular development opportunities is not helpful for people trying to maintain work/life balance.
-Mediocre pay/benefits
-The combination of these factors is leading many of the most talented individuals to pursue opportunities elsewhere
